On Fri, 9 Jan 1998, Anthony Lemons wrote:

> Are any of the Livingston routers capable of handling multihoming between
> two providers?

Yes. You want the 114. It has 2 t1 ports, and can run BGP.
Or even the PM 3 could do this but then youd have no way to feed any
dialups into it. This is why I think the PM3 should have come with a
minimum of 3 or even 4 t1/pri ports in the beginning. ;-)
